The Palmdale School District Board of Trustees held a meeting on April 7, 2026, focusing primarily on student achievement reports, school programs, and community engagement initiatives. Key procurement-related actions included approval of a tribal cultural resource management agreement for a site monitoring project at the ELOP Center with a budget not to exceed $6,000, and a professional services contract with Leaf Engineered for Title 24 commissioning services at the Palmdale Academy Charter Campus gym for $29,000. The board also approved contracts for after-school programs, including a $2,500 agreement with the California State Soccer Association South for soccer courses and a $3,700 contract with Interlink for an online Lego Robotics League platform. Additionally, agreements were ratified for coaching and consulting services totaling over $226,000, funded by teacher effectiveness grants. Transportation service agreements were approved, including a no-cost maintenance agreement for district buses and a $25,000 contract with Westside Union School District for transportation services. The board adopted resolutions related to state facilities bond programs and recognized National Library Week. Budget discussions included community school partnership program funding, with reported expenditures and matching grants totaling several million dollars. The meeting concluded with personnel approvals and recognition of various school achievements and community programs.
